The first member of struct ScanTable is a simple pointer, extra alignment
of which serves no purpose. The alignment specifier was added along with
some Altivec optimisations also adding a 16-byte-aligned array at the end
of struct ScanTable. Presumably the redundant, outer alignment was added
by mistake. The inner one is clearly sufficient.
